Frequently Asked Questions about Rio Pinar

What type of rentals are currently available in Rio Pinar?

There are currently 38 Apartments for Rent in Rio Pinar,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,100 to $4,370. There are also 69 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Rio Pinar ranging from $1,095 to $3,459.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Rio Pinar?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Rio Pinar ranges from $1,095 to $3,459 with an average monthly rent of $2,230.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Rio Pinar?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Rio Pinar range from $1,407 to $3,874,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,795 to $3,400.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,300 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,808.
